Is your mechanic sure it's the module and not just a sensor? To check yourself, engage reverse gear with your ignition on (engine off) and put your ear to each of your sensors - sensors which are working will make a faint, audible clicking sound. If none of the sensors are clicking then it is a very high probability that the module is at fault. If any of sensors are clicking then the module will be OK, you will only need to change the sensors that do not work.

To hear any clicking more clearly, put the tip of a screwdriver against the centre of each sensor and press the end of the handle to your ear.
Use a dependable source for used spares, such as AutoReserve and make sure the replacement module has a part number compatible with your original module.

There's a difference between modules for front and rear park assist and those for just rear assist
